In home decor, a floor lamp is more than just a lighting tool; it's also a powerful way to create atmosphere and enhance the aesthetics of a space. However, many people, after purchasing their favorite floor lamp, struggle to decide where to place it.

The living room is the most common home for a floor lamp. If you have a comfortable sofa or armchair in your living room, placing a floor lamp next to it can easily create a cozy reading corner. The soft light not only helps with eyesight but also allows you to immerse yourself in a book.
Beyond reading light, floor lamps can also serve as supplemental lighting in the living room, filling in areas where the main light source is insufficient. Placing them next to the sofa or TV stand provides a soft, evenly distributed light source, avoiding glare from direct sunlight.
In the bedroom, a floor lamp serves more as a mood-enhancing feature. Placing it near the bed or in a corner provides a soft, non-disturbing light, replacing a harsh bedside lamp. Especially at night, the warm glow of a floor lamp can create a warm and tranquil space, helping you relax and drift off to sweet dreams.
If your bedroom has a dressing table or workbench, opt for an adjustable floor lamp to provide targeted lighting in these areas.
While dining rooms often feature pendant lights, a floor lamp can complement them and add a sense of formality to dining. Placed next to a sideboard or in a corner, it provides soft, ambient light, creating a romantic and cozy dining atmosphere.
There's no set standard for the placement of a floor lamp; it depends on your home style and practical needs. Whether in the living room, bedroom, or study, a floor lamp, when used strategically, can become one of your home's most striking decorative pieces.
